Garbage disposals are convenient kitchen accessories but you have to take care to use them properly. When rinsing food down the drain, always use cold water, as hot water can liquefy the grease, which can coagulate and build up over time. You can help to clean the disposal by grinding egg shells or fruit pits in it from time to time. In addition, avoid putting items such as bones, glass, paper, potato peels, cooking oil, coffee grounds and harsh chemicals in a disposal, as these can cause a variety of plumbing problems.

If attempting a plumbing repair yourself, be sure and have plenty of buckets on hand to catch spilling water. While you may have turned off the water supply, there is always some water left in the pipes and the larger the home and more extensive the plumbing system, the more water you may encounter.

If you are not able to shut off a main valve to your home before you leave for vacation, shut off the individual valves under the sinks and behind the toilets. Be sure that the valves are in good working order before you make the mistake of turning one that is ready to be broken at any time.

Your water heater works more during the fall and winter so make sure that you eliminate all sediment buildup around this piece of equipment. Flushing this device can lead to increased longevity so that you do not face plumbing problems during the winter. This precaution will save time, money and effort.

Never flush menstrual products, such as pads or tampons, even if the box says it’s okay. These products can cause major clogs in your plumbing that cannot be removed with a simple plunger. Ensure that all women in your household understand the importance of placing these items in an appropriate receptacle.
